中太平洋北部锰结核中的微量元素

TRACE ELEMENTS IN MANGANESE NODULES FROM THE NORTHERN PART OF THE CENTRAL PACIFIC OCEAN

摘要 中太平洋北部锰结核中的微量元素分析表明,调查区具有经济价值的金属元素Cu,Ni,Co,Zn,Pb以及Sr含量很高。尤其是Cu,Zn,Pb和Sr,比世界大洋锰结核中的平均含量高出一个数量级,其他微量元素与世界大洋和太平洋的数值接近。借助于聚类分析把相关强的元素分为三组。第一组为Co,Sr,V,Pb;第二组为Cu,Zn,Ni,Li;第三组为Cr和K。这种共生组合反映了结核的形成机制。研究表明,锰结核中大多数微量元素受到主要元素的支配,这些主要元素又与结核中的主要矿物有关。因此,锰结核中的一些微量元素的含量变化,能够反映出主要成矿元素丰度特征和形成时的环境条件。通过微量元素的研究和环境参数的测定,为评价矿物资源提供科学依据。 Analysis of the trace elements in the manganese nodules from the northern part of the Central Pacific Ocean shows that economically valuable elements such as Ni, Cu, Zn, Co, Pb, and Sr are quite rich in the investigation area. Particularly, the contents of Cu, Zn, Pb and Sr are higher by one order of magnitude than the their average contents in the manganese nodules in the world oceans. The contents of the other trace elements are close to their average contents in the world eceans.By cluster analysis, the trace elements that are strongly correlated were divided into three groups: the first group is Co, Sr, V and Pb; the second one is Cu, Zn, Ni and Li; and the third one is Cr and K. The relation of inter- growth and association indicates the developing mechanism of manganese nodules.The results of the study show that most the trace elements are controlled by major elements in manganese nodules. The major elements are also related to the major minerals in manganese nodules. Therefore, the variations of the contents of some trace elements in nodules can show characteristics of the abundance of major mineralization elements and the environmental condition for their formation. The study on the trace elements in manganese nodules and determination of the environment parameters provided a scientific basis for evaluation of mineral resources.
